Reality for Rising Food Prices....
Thu, 24 Apr 2008 17:21:11 PDT
Hundreds of millions of people have moved from poverty into the global economy over the past decade in Asia. Theyre eating twice a day, instead of once, and propelling rapid urbanization. Their demand for food staples and once unthinkable luxuries like meat is pushing up prices. At the same time, the rising price of commodities over the past year has largely tracked the declining parity of the beleaguered dollar.
